The Mayan Ruins

 Tulum_Mayans.png

 

If you love ancient buildings, you probably already know about the popular Mayan ruins, which are located in Tulum. Before centuries that was a city of the ancient Mayans, which was built on the top of a cliff, which has an incredible view over the magical beach of Tulum.

Sea Turtles

 Tulum_SeaTurtle_Diving.png

 

All the way from May to November, in the area of Tulum, a massive population of turtles is coming to enjoy the soft sands and crystal clear waters. So, you not only can see the turtles on the sand but while you dive in the water. In order to see that beauty, you will have to head north from Tulum, and as there are limitations of how many people can go in the water to see the turtles, we strongly advise you to hire a local guide to go with you or go very early, to avoid the crowd.

Q: When is the best time to visit Tulum?
A: When you are planning to visit Tulum, you should be very careful with the dates you book. You should know that December is the coolest month, whereas May is the hottest, so you should comply with that. Probably, the best time to visit Tulum is from February, all the way to May. We highly advise you to avoid the period from June to October, which in Tulum is the rainy season.
